Calculate your chart →People project confusion and uncertainty onto you even after you've already found your own way. Others see someone who doesn't know what they're doing, start directing and criticizing you — exhausting, especially when you're already fine.
Your strength is holding your ground without giving in to those projections — without needing to explain yourself, justify yourself, or prove anything. It takes courage to accept that some people will always see you as confused, regardless of what's actually true.
What matters is not becoming the victim of someone else's "order" — a strong-willed controller offering to manage your chaos, at the risk of you losing your own direction in the process. Your task is telling apart genuinely accepting support from quietly agreeing to someone else's control.
